## Runbook: Feedproof Validator — Security Notes

The Feedproof validator fetches podcast feeds over outbound-only connections and never follows redirects across domains. All fetched XML is parsed with external entities disabled; any feed triggering an entity expansion is quarantined and logged. Review the quarantine bucket weekly. The fetch worker runs under a restricted service account, with its behavior governed by the following configuration values.

config for kajog-yajof:
[praiel]
host = praiel.nelvrodata.test
user = praiel_svc
database = praiel_prod

Subject: QueueScale cut-over — summary

Hi, welcome aboard. On Tuesday we completed the cut-over of the Drossel ingestion tier to QueueScale, our queue-depth autoscaler. Scaling decisions now derive from per-partition backlog rather than CPU, which removed the oscillation we saw during the Harkvale launch. Please review the decision log before making any changes. For reference, the active production configuration is reproduced below.

deployment values, kajep-kageg:
[praix]
host = praix.paliqcorp.corp
user = praix_svc
database = praix_prod

Export Retry Recovery — Driftgate

Failed exports in Driftgate retry automatically three times. If the exporter service account is locked, retries stall and the queue grows. Check the lockout flag on the exporter identity before touching the queue. Do not purge pending jobs. Run the account-recovery flow from the ops console, confirm the identity fingerprint, and resume the retry worker afterward. When prompted, enter the recovery passphrase that appears on the next line.

vault phrase of tawig-taduf = zorath-oliwyn